Gutter Cleaning in Morris County, NJ

Gutter cleaning services involve the removal of leaves, debris, and obstructions from the gutters and downspouts of residential properties. This process helps ensure proper water flow away from the foundation, preventing potential water damage, basement flooding, and landscape erosion. Projects typically include inspecting and clearing gutters, flushing out any remaining debris, and verifying that downspouts are functioning correctly. Homeowners often request this service to maintain the integrity of their roofing system and to avoid costly repairs caused by clogged or overflowing gutters.

Before requesting gutter cleaning, property owners usually want to understand what areas will be covered, the type of debris that will be removed, and whether the service includes inspecting the overall gutter system for damage or leaks. Clarifying if the project involves any additional work, such as gutter repairs or installation of guards, can also be helpful. Properly maintained gutters contribute to the longevity of the roofing system and protect the property’s foundation, making routine cleaning an important part of property upkeep.

Common Gutter Cleaning Jobs

Gutter Cleaning - removal of leaves and debris to prevent water overflow and damage.

Gutter Inspection - checking for leaks, clogs, and proper drainage to maintain gutter performance.

Gutter Flushing - thorough rinsing of gutters and downspouts to clear blockages and buildup.

Downspout Clearing - removing obstructions from downspouts to ensure proper water flow away from the foundation.

Gutter Maintenance - routine checks and minor repairs to extend gutter system lifespan.

Gutter Protection Installation - adding guards or screens to reduce debris accumulation and simplify upkeep.

Gutter Cleaning Questions

Why should gutter cleaning be scheduled regularly? Regular cleaning prevents clogs, water damage, and potential foundation issues by ensuring proper water flow away from the property.

What types of debris are typically removed during gutter cleaning? Common debris includes leaves, twigs, dirt, and small nests that can block water flow and cause damage.

Is gutter cleaning necessary after storms? Yes, storm debris like leaves and branches can quickly clog gutters, making cleaning important to maintain proper drainage.

How do clogged gutters affect a home? Clogged gutters can lead to water overflow, roof damage, mold growth, and foundation problems if not addressed promptly.
